**Step-by-Step Solution:** 1. **Understanding the Question**: The question asks for the last electron acceptor during the Electron Transport System (ETS) in respiration. 2. **Defining ETS**: The Electron Transport System (ETS) is a series of protein complexes located in the inner mitochondrial membrane that facilitate the transfer of electrons derived from nutrients. This process is crucial for ATP production. 3. **Identifying Electron Acceptors**: In the ETS, electrons are transferred from one carrier to another. The question provides four options for the last electron acceptor: - Oxygen - Cytochrome A - Cytochrome A2 - Cytochrome A3 4. **Determining the Final Electron Acceptor**: The final electron acceptor in the ETS is essential for the completion of the electron transport chain. It is known that oxygen acts as the terminal electron acceptor. 5. **Formation of Water**: When oxygen accepts electrons, it combines with protons (H+) to form water (H2O). This reaction is crucial for maintaining the flow of electrons through the ETS and for the production of ATP. 6. **Conclusion**: Based on the understanding of the ETS and the role of oxygen, the correct answer to the question is that the last electron acceptor during the ETS is **oxygen**. **Final Answer**: The last electron acceptor during ETS is **oxygen**. ---
